
Birbhum, located in West Bengal, is known for its rich cultural heritage and artistic traditions, particularly in folk music, dance, and painting. The district is also famous for its Shantiniketan, the home of Nobel laureate Rabindranath Tagore?s Visva-Bharati University, which has made it a prominent center for art, culture, and education. The region's economy is primarily agricultural, with rice, maize, and jute being some of the key crops. Birbhum is also famous for its Baul music and vibrant festivals like Poush Mela and Durga Puja, which draw many visitors. The district is dotted with religious sites, including the Tarapith Temple, an important Shakti Peeth, and other ancient temples. Santiniketan is an international cultural hub, with students from all over the world coming to study here. The district has a rich tribal culture, with many indigenous communities contributing to its diversity. The development of infrastructure, including roads and healthcare, is on the rise, and tourism is growing as a result of the cultural significance of Birbhum.
